Output d84a6061b4033390bf30577a805a0b697175d6cb05e98fb001bdcc9c70b270bf:2

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bdcaa73c5e8d155d3ecbe962752ae232dcfc237 OP_EQUAL
address
38c8x4Xa7T1pNrYM7N2ddyUKAYtS6fMDC3
transaction
d84a6061b4033390bf30577a805a0b697175d6cb05e98fb001bdcc9c70b270bf
spent
true